Commonly Asked Questions about Professional Contracts

Professional contracts, also known as professional services contracts or personal services contracts, are agreements entered into by organizations and their contractors to provide specialized services, normally for a short time.
How to write a client contract Include contact information of both parties. Outline project terms and scope. Create payment terms. Set a schedule. Decide what to do if a contract is terminated. Determine who owns final copyrights. Clarify the working relationship. Choose your law and venue. A professional services contract is defined as a contract structure between a professional services firm or consultant and the client that dictates the expectations of each party. It dictates who bears risk, when money changes hands, and how the final project-based service is to be delivered.
A PSA is a legally binding contract between two parties. Its a type of consulting agreement wherein an independent contractor helps a business to achieve a defined goal. A PSA allows for the boundaries of the professional relationship between a client and service provider to be clearly defined.
